Biotechnologie in Praag
Start date: Jun 1, 2015, End date: May 31, 2017 PROJECT  FINISHED 

1. What is BIOPRA 2017? BIOPRA stands for Biotechnology in Prague. The project is a 2-week long mobility-project of the European program Erasmus + Leonardo da Vinci. The partner in Czech Republik is the Forest establishment in Kostelec nad Cernymi Lesy. The Forest establishment is a company of the University of Lifesciences in Prague. The tutor is Dr. Pavel Karnet, assistant director of the Forest Establishment. The sending partner is Bernardusscholen 5, part of Bernardusscholen Oudenaarde. Promotor is director Patrick Vansteenbrugge. A whole team of teachers is responsable for the preparation and leading the project. 2. For whom? The Erasmus+ BIOPRA 2017 will be realised for the whole Class of 6th year Biotechnical Sciences (6 TBW) of the school Bernardusscholen 5, Oudenaarde, Belgium. The group is composed of about 21 students of 17-LB years old. There will be also 7 accompanying - attendino teachers for the whole period of the project in Czech republik (1 teacher for the whole period of 17 days, 6 teachers will share the other period en accompany each for 8 days). 3. When and where? Although the preparations of the project will start a year before we go abroad, the project itself will start on monday 8 th of may 2017 and end on wednesday the 24th of may 2017. This means we will have 11 working days, 2 traveling days and the weekends can be used for cultural activities. All workingactivities will take place in the neighbourhood of Kostelec Nad Cernymi Lesy and Prague. 4. whv? The school wants to give the students of the section Biotechnical Sciences a contemporary training and education in a European context to qualify in modern technlques of biotechnology, with focus on the biological and ecological aspects According to the vision of the European Union concerning the policy in agriculture, our agriculture should make the evolution of massproduction to a sustainable agriculture, with far more attention for the environ. This expires some new social requieries. The 6 goals for Europe (and Flanders) are: - Food (production) - Feed (animal feed production) - Fuel (alternative energy, energiy out of agriculture) - Fibre (natural fibres as wel as synthetic fibres , with the agriculture as source) - Flower (production of domestic plants , saving the landscape) - Fun (tourisme in nature, on farms) The most important aim of the project is to let our pupils experience these goals on modern factories and scientific centres. The specific aims of BIOPRA are close to the aims of the Erasmus+ program: to support young people through education an skills. To qualify our students and make them citizens that can take part in the labourmarket, throughout Europe. We are sure that with this project our students will experience a very motivating labourpractice in foodproduction, forestery and biotechnology. Practicaly the items of food and feed will be experienced in the fishponds, at the organic goatfarm in Novy Dvur, the breeding of biochikens and Holsteincows in Lany., the winery of Melnik. Experiences in research and preservation of the environment (Flower) will be obtained through practices in the arboretum, the ornamental nursery, tree nursery and the forest. Also the working experiences in the laboratories of different departments of CULS will show the students the need of a scientific approach in order to obtain these goals. Practice in the village Knezice will show the possibilities and new evolutions in energyproduction.
